Cloths that come back grey
Coffee oil, milk protein and syrup are not the same soil as food service. Washed on a general cycle they build up, whites go dull within weeks, and the counter is where it shows.

Why does cafe linen fade faster than kitchen linen?
It is the wash, not the cloth. On a general cycle they build up and whites dull within weeks.
- Cafe cloths and aprons run on their own classification — not as the tail end of a kitchen load.
- Milk protein needs the right temperature, not just a hotter one — too hot sets it into the fibre.
- Grey whites are usually a wash problem, not an age problem — a Upper Norwood cafe buying aprons three times a year is paying for a bad cycle, not for wear.
